Job Overview:
We are looking for someone who can work directly with enterprise customers to design, build, and deliver cloud foundations that support large-scale platforms and migration programs.
This is a consulting role with real hands-on depth. You will not just advise—you will build alongside delivery teams and own the technical outcomes.
Key Responsibilities:
- Design and implement AWS Landing Zones (Control Tower, AFT, multi-account strategy) with governance, networking, identity, and security baselines
- Define cloud platform strategies for application modernization, database migrations, container orchestration (EKS), and hybrid architecture
- Build and optimize Infrastructure CI/CD pipelines using Azure DevOps or similar (YAML pipelines, service connections, environments, approvals) with Terraform/Terragrunt as the primary IaC tool
- Design Terraform module architectures, including reusable modules, remote state management, workspace strategies, and drift detection for enterprise-scale AWS environments
- Establish governance frameworks using AWS Service Control Policies, IAM, Cost Explorer, tagging strategies, and compliance guardrails—all deployed and enforced through CI/CD
- Lead platform engineering efforts, including EKS cluster design, networking (VPC Transit Gateway, PrivateLink), and security architecture
- Implement observability and monitoring strategies using CloudWatch, Datadog, or similar tooling
- Guide and mentor delivery teams through complex technical decisions
